Highlights
Are people in State College older or younger than people in Hudson?
- The Median Age in State College is 17.5 years younger than in Hudson.

Are housing costs cheaper in State College or Hudson?
- State College housing costs are 2.4% more expensive than Hudson hous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, State College or Hudson?
- The average commute for residents of State College is 4.8 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Hudson.

Things to do in Hudson?
Living in Hudson, NY is a unique and pleasant experience. The city has an interesting mix of old and new architecture, making it a beautiful and vibrant place to be. The streets are lined with charming cafes, restaurants, galleries, and boutiques, providing plenty of options for entertainment. Additionally, the town is home to a variety of festivals throughout the year celebrating its diversity and culture. Despite its small size, Hudson offers a great quality of life with plenty of parks and outdoor recreation opportunities to enjoy. It's truly a wonderful place to call home!
